Navigating a World of Reviews: Finding What's Trustworthy

In today’s digital age, we rely heavily on reviews to direct our decisions. From choosing a restaurant to purchasing a new gadget, reviews offer valuable opinions. However, with the abundance of online reviews, it can be difficult to discern what is authentic.

Begin by recognizing the source of the review. Look for feedback on reputable websites or platforms known for their credibility. Pay attention to the author's profile and history.

A reviewer with a established track record of providing valuable reviews is more apt to be reliable. Consider the general tone and substance of the review. Search for concrete examples and avoid reviews that are overly enthusiastic or negative. Remember that every reviewer has their own taste, so it's here important to consider multiple reviews following making a decision.

Ultimately, navigating the world of reviews requires a critical eye. By following these tips, you can improve your chances of finding trustworthy reviews that will guide your choices with confidence.

Detecting Fabricated Feedback: Protecting Trust in the Digital Age

In today's online realm, consumer trust is paramount. Shoppers frequently depend online reviews to guide their buying choices. However, the rise of fake reviews poses a significant threat to this trust. These phony testimonials can deceive shoppers, leading to undesirable results. It is essential to expose these deceptions and protect the integrity of online reviews.

An essential tactic involves leveraging machine learning algorithms to recognize anomalies in review text and user behavior. Furthermore, platforms need to tackle fake reviews by implementing robust monitoring systems. Consumers, too, can play a role by exercising discernment and reporting suspicious activity. Only through a joint action can we restore trust in the digital age.
